Dick Hardt on SXIP
My interview with Dick Hardt, now online at IT Conversations, will hardly convince anyone that SXIP is the one, true way to implement federated identity management, but it could help inject doubt into the notion that the heavyweight Liberty Alliance/SAML solutions are the only identity protocol game in town.
